Postmortem timeline — Dateline project, locale rollout. 09:14: reports from Veldmark users that appointment dates rendered month-first despite regional settings. 09:31: confirmed the formatter fell back to a hardcoded pattern when the locale pack failed to load. 10:02: hotfix deployed gating the fallback behind a warning. 10:20: metrics normal. New team members: locale packs ship separately from the app bundle, which is why this slipped through. The offending build's trace token is recorded below.

session token of tajef-bageg = htk21_5d90d574934f3ccae6437

### Step 4: Pin the Fablecrate factory registry

Before the weekly sync, every team should migrate their test suites off the implicit global registry, which Fablecrate 3.x removes. Declare factories explicitly per suite; shared fixtures move to the commons package. Once migrated, the library reads its settings from a checked-in file containing the following values.

settings of fafog-haduf:
ZORIX_PIN=4648
ZORIX_METRICS_HOST=metrics.zorix.paliqsys.corp
ZORIX_LOG_LEVEL=info
ZORIX_TENANT=druix

09:40 — Darya flipped the Ostrell pipeline to the hermetic Bramble build system and the first run failed on an undeclared font dependency. New team members should note this is expected: hermetic builds surface every implicit input the old setup silently pulled from the host. She declared the dependency and reran. The passing run carries the token below.

trace token, fafog-kageg: htk4_98e6

**Checklist item 7: Access the temporary site at Harrowgate Annex.**

While the main Delling House building is under renovation, all new starters report to the Harrowgate Annex on Pemberly Row. Arrive by 8:45 on your first day, sign the visitor ledger at the portacabin marked "Site Office," and collect your hard hat if directed past the hoarding. The annex side door stays locked at all times, so you will need the entry code below.

door code, kawip-bagap: bdg-HQEWH-4